Is Catalyst worth the price?

65/10

Catalyst's pricing, hidden behind 'Contact Sales' for both Growth and Enterprise tiers, suggests a premium offering likely tailored for mid-market to enterprise clients.

This opaque approach makes it difficult to assess fairness without direct quotes, but it's common for platforms with extensive features and dedicated support. It's best for organizations with complex customer success needs and a substantial budget.

Hidden Costs & Gotchas

Pricing is custom, requiring sales engagement

Annual billing only for listed tiers

Potential for high minimum contract values

Enterprise features tied to Totango platform

How Catalyst Compares to Competitors

Compared to platforms like ChurnZero, which often starts around $400-$500/month for smaller teams, Catalyst's 'Contact Sales' model implies a significantly higher entry point, likely in the thousands per month. Gainsight, another enterprise competitor, also uses custom pricing but is generally perceived as the market leader, making Catalyst's value proposition harder to discern without transparent pricing.
